Suzlon Energy’s stock surged 5% in the morning trade to hit a high of Rs 29.50 and was the top volume gainer in the market. The stock has surged over 10% in the last 3 days and is also trading higher than its daily average volumes.

The stock has surged for three consecutive days after the company’s promoters released 97.1 crore pledged shares from SBICAP Trustee Company Ltd.

Recently, the shares hit their highest point in eight years, and in 2023 alone, they’ve gone up by more than 150%.

As of 11:55 AM, Suzlon Energy’s shares were up by 4.98%, or 1.40, priced at ₹29.50.
